Michele A. DeBiasse is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, General Health Professions and Clinical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Michele A. DeBiasse has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 363 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 3 papers in General Health Professions and 2 papers in Clinical Psychology. Recurrent topics in Michele A. DeBiasse’s work include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(4 papers), Nutritional Studies and Diet (3 papers) and Eating Disorders and Behaviors (2 papers). Michele A. DeBiasse is often cited by papers focused on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(4 papers), Nutritional Studies and Diet (3 papers) and Eating Disorders and Behaviors (2 papers). Michele A. DeBiasse collaborates with scholars based in United States. Michele A. DeBiasse's co-authors include Kristin L. Schneider, Sherry Pagoto, Mirjana Jojic, David Mann, Robert H. Demling, Deborah J. Bowen, Lisa M. Quintiliani, Jessica Oleski, Andrew M. Busch and Matthew C. Whited and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Molecular Ecology and American Journal of Preventive Medicine.
